Definitions of siderophile:
- noun: (chemistry, geology) In the Goldschmidt classification, an element that forms alloys easily with iron and is concentrated in the Earth's core.
- noun: A siderophile element, tissue, or cell.
- adjective: (of a cell or tissue) Having an affinity for iron.
- adjective: (geology) Having an affinity for metallic iron.
